|
EDA365欢迎您登录!
您需要 登录 才可以下载或查看,没有帐号?注册
x
: N5 J- z: D1 k$ e) X2 H
参看:" ]& L& J3 \1 L' W1 m
! u8 J" Q0 k5 H$ ~#arch #显示机器的处理器架构( E) L. e1 |, X- l
# uname -a # 查看内核/操作系统/CPU信息
- u: T$ ^, n. A9 f3 f# head -n 1 /etc/issue # 查看操作系统版本
1 M/ X6 A/ b, e4 K% [* |- b# hostname # 查看计算机名7 w6 [5 ]% h' a }
# lspci -tv # 列出所有PCI设备. u6 V1 F* K( b6 w6 V0 _1 d$ h, g3 G
# lsusb -tv # 列出所有USB设备# C { z. I/ ^+ U3 s: |
# lsmod # 列出加载的内核模块) G- H* X5 b0 j, k# ]
# env # 查看环境变量资源
* D6 U# S8 F+ B% r- s9 S5 \4 F# free -m # 查看内存使用量和交换区使用量3 G8 v$ n% L+ P3 l) q
# df -h # 查看各分区使用情况
, L; `+ g. D7 \* K# du -sh <目录名> # 查看指定目录的大小0 F8 t Q7 x- ^' P8 U
# grep MemTotal /proc/meminfo # 查看内存总量
7 ]6 o' p/ B7 k0 V0 P$ q7 o* A9 Q# grep MemFree /proc/meminfo # 查看空闲内存量( ~% G1 t1 q6 U7 o' f
# uptime # 查看系统运行时间、用户数、负载
" G- `. @' ~: v" `+ K# vmstat # 查看详细系统运行信息. J, P( M+ G: n) k2 B3 v7 |. D( p6 j! V
# cat /proc/loadavg # 查看系统负载磁盘和分区
$ [+ Q+ C0 S' `/ x/ _( b# mount | column -t # 查看挂接的分区状态+ ]; E+ y5 K' Y5 n: n# a
# fdisk -l # 查看所有分区4 b& M7 [2 P$ _( K
# swapon -s # 查看所有交换分区! K+ i* w! q, k# b
# dmesg | grep IDE # 查看启动时IDE设备检测状况网络
( l! Y; i K# n& ?( B7 L- F- [3 I% h# ifconfig # 查看所有网络接口的属性
/ R6 I- h" K; x0 u# iptables -L # 查看防火墙设置
3 }' q! f6 j6 f2 Z; @# route -n # 查看路由表
! n. r6 u: }+ e8 w$ p& {5 z# netstat -lntp # 查看所有监听端口
* P( \# O" k" Q' K4 o/ H1 w# netstat -antp # 查看所有已经建立的连接
9 q2 l. u! O* j# netstat -s # 查看网络统计信息进程
8 _$ `* s' u1 t2 S$ F# ps -ef # 查看所有进程
3 i3 e T/ J( h9 E% r% P; {# top # 实时显示进程状态用户
+ l- Y! S& q0 W4 ?; k r/ F i( G5 a# w # 查看活动用户* |* }" H2 ^0 v1 ~1 v$ C
# id <用户名> # 查看指定用户信息
& t% [3 O5 y4 g$ C" ?% V [9 x! x# last # 查看用户登录日志
1 W) w8 G2 F. G( b0 n' b5 B# cut -d: -f1 /etc/passwd # 查看系统所有用户
3 h: T" z h0 Q; ~( x5 K# cut -d: -f1 /etc/group # 查看系统所有组 I$ ^0 \; N! M$ K# i0 ^& i
# crontab -l # 查看当前用户的计划任务服务
/ p& S6 K5 b% R6 k6 n# chkconfig –list # 列出所有系统服务. g( ?+ u0 i4 Q; K! R5 \
# chkconfig –list | grep on # 列出所有启动的系统服务程序3 b9 ?6 w9 |- k3 P
# rpm -qa # 查看所有安装的软件包: u6 z U/ r8 f5 |; S
# stat 显示指定文件的详细信息,比ls更详细
% Y3 o! R; ]; c8 l! |8 J# who #显示在线登陆用户
' U+ ?- l* A p. I# whoami #显示当前操作用户) f; M! d$ u% f0 i: @9 Q7 O4 c2 b% k
# ping #测试网络连通
# j; A4 C5 L" g' P$ P/ K/ A# clear #清屏
3 u5 w/ i- ] g2 R3 c# alias #对命令重命名 如:alias showmeit=”ps -aux” ,另外解除使用unaliax , Y. C5 n1 S2 r- u/ w5 r
# kill #杀死进程,可以先用ps 或 top命令查看进程的id,然后再用kill命令杀死进程。3 ` r( A1 D2 C) S: q- I/ o
) H6 u; z3 Y1 T
Useradd 创建一个新的用户
* R# E/ r/ ?/ G( X' a, N# A5 zGroupadd 组名 创建一个新的组 8 Q: T1 D4 ]6 {
Passwd 用户名 为用户创建密码
1 v6 T5 t0 N" `. l. [/ BPasswd -d用户名 删除用户密码也能登陆 : P7 R$ e/ `6 K- B
Passwd -S用户名 查询账号密码 1 u' g1 l; D4 @# j& k* }: g
Usermod -l 新用户名 老用户名 为用户改名 4 ~( L/ G8 [. J* U. P( U
Userdel–r 用户名 删除用户一切
/ x7 L* A1 I" ]$ s$ z0 u" m3 r
2 p8 D( Z D1 R" J% n
K3 F4 A5 `: Clinux 中许多常用命令是必须掌握的,这里将我学linux入门时学的一些常用的基本命令分享给大家一下,希望可以帮助你们。1 \6 [$ u2 p, X. A
" K4 }+ s0 [1 t
8 s7 K5 z' W J, j3 v% g( P& S5 m
+ c! h/ o( B6 Q9 M; Z M ~ a
: K! n, R! I! l& F- w7 f P
0 o- \) e1 W# \; w) I6 Y T( m: t" @' r6 B: U
2 O, k% e5 b8 y1 \2 N5 A% V
7 b9 h! Q( M; M4 _. e9 ^/ G# t9 s/ J3 |# d7 D9 {
: E" K9 ~9 L3 m# |. i! ? i
: F* N# s \2 O |
|